    Question

    Are the data in the mfhd_item table (e.g., ITEM_ENUM, CHRON) stored in UTF-8 or some other character set?

    Answer

    Only bibliographic data are stored as Unicode in Voyager, and the rest is Latin1. Since the mfhd_item table is not bibliographic data, it is stored in Latin1. 

    Additional Information

    "MARC data" is stored in MARC21-UTF-8 format in Voyager.  This includes BIB records and MFHD records.
